Title :
Customized adaptive algorithm for deadlock-free routing in irregular mesh NoC

Abstract :
An irregular mesh NoC is characterized by missing nodes and missing links due to the presence of oversized IP cores. Due to these missing links, traditional adaptive routing algorithms cannot be applied. This gives rise to a need to develop a routing algorithm which can make decisions dynamically by obtaining information about the link failures. This paper presents a customized west first routing algorithm for an irregular mesh NoC. We formulated an adaptive routing scheme for irregular mesh. The proposed customized west first routing algorithm avoids deadlocks and enables interleaving of packets for efficiency. The interleaving of flits is supported by the packet manager which keeps track of packet id thus enabling sequential packet reception. The routing logic supports both unicast and multicast communication. The adaptive nature of the algorithm reduces the latency and reduces packet loss in the network and hence improves the reliability. Hence the customized west first routing algorithm has been found to be reliable in terms of packet passing in multicast conflict scenarios.
